How did Umicore build trust and identity?
Umicore turned a 120-year industrial past into a brand known for metals know-how and recycling. In 2025, demand for battery materials and low-carbon supply kept its name visible with investors and buyers.
That shift matters because trust came from operations, not ads. The Umicore Balanced Scorecard helps show how legacy strength and cleaner growth now shape its reputation.
How Was Umicore Founded and First Perceived?
Umicore started in 1906 as Union Minière du Haut Katanga, a mining and metals operator tied to the Belgian Congo. The first market view came from scale, extraction, and metallurgical skill, not from consumer-style branding. Trust came from control of resources and technical strength, while the colonial setting later shaped how Umicore history would be judged.
The first strong signal was not image, but output. Umicore company brand trust began with a clear role in mining and metals, where competence mattered more than messaging.
That early identity still sits behind how Umicore became a global materials technology company. It also explains why Umicore corporate branding later had to move from extraction toward cleaner materials, recycling, and stronger public trust.
- Early market impression: serious industrial operator.
- Observers first noticed scale and metals expertise.
- Trust came from resource access and technical skill.
- Later, colonial links required brand repair.
In Umicore brand development over time, the firm's first reputation was built inside heavy industry, not in public marketing. That matters for how Umicore positions itself in the market today, because the modern story of Umicore sustainability strategy and Umicore recycling business has to sit on top of a legacy that began with extraction.
The original business model created hard proof points: ore access, processing know-how, and industrial reach. Those signals shaped what makes Umicore a trusted brand now, but they also left a gap between old extraction-led identity and later Umicore sustainability and brand image.
For investors and analysts, the early lesson is simple: Umicore corporate reputation strategy did not start with green technology branding. It started with metallurgical credibility, then had to evolve for a world that now expects circular economy proof, not just production strength. Read more in Brand Demand of Umicore Company
Umicore SWOT Analysis
- Organized to Save Time on Analysis
- Fully Customizable
- Editable in Excel & Word
- Professional Formatting
- Investor-Ready Format
How Did Umicore's Brand Grow and Evolve?
Umicore's brand grew as the business moved away from upstream mining and toward higher-value materials technology. The 2001 rebrand helped reset how customers, investors, and partners saw the business: less as a metals group, more as a science-led supplier for cleaner industry.
The 2001 name change was the biggest break in Umicore history and a key step in how did Umicore build its brand. It signaled a move from legacy metallurgy to specialty materials, and that change made Umicore's brand operations and market reset easier to understand. Over time, catalysts, recycling, and battery materials gave the Umicore company brand a clearer, more modern identity.
The brand came to stand for process know-how, science, and environmental relevance, which is central to Umicore corporate branding and Umicore brand development over time. That positioning helped shape Umicore sustainability strategy and Umicore sustainability and brand image around circularity, clean mobility, and industrial trust. In market terms, it became a Umicore recycling and circular economy brand with stronger Umicore market positioning in materials technology.
Its business mix also changed the story. As the Umicore recycling business and battery-related activities became more visible, the brand started to support how Umicore positions itself in the market as a materials technology company instead of a commodity producer. That is a core part of Umicore innovation and brand building and a big reason what makes Umicore a trusted brand is tied to both technical depth and environmental use cases.
For investors, this shaped Umicore investor perception and brand strength and reinforced Umicore company values and brand identity. The group's focus on catalysts, recycling, specialty materials, and rechargeable battery materials made the brand easier to link to long-term industrial trends. Put simply, Umicore green technology branding helped the business look more future-facing and more relevant to customers that care about performance and sustainability.
Umicore Ansoff Matrix
- Structured to Support Better Decisions
- Effortlessly Communicate Your Business Strategy
- Investor-Ready Format
- 100% Editable and Customizable
- Clear and Structured Layout
What Changed Umicore's Reputation Over Time?
Umicore company brand strengthened when its business shifted from legacy mining to cleaner industrial themes. Exiting mining, scaling precious-metal recycling, and serving catalytic converters and battery materials made how did Umicore build its brand easier to see in market terms. But slower EV demand, project delays, and impairment charges have also shown that Brand Ownership of Umicore Company depends on delivery, not just green messaging.
| Year | Reputation-Shaping Event | How It Affected the Brand |
|---|---|---|
| 2001 | Exit from direct mining | Moving away from mining helped reset Umicore corporate branding around materials technology, recycling, and industrial know-how rather than extractive legacy. |
| 2007 | Growth in precious-metal recycling | Building the Umicore recycling business strengthened its environmental credibility and made Umicore sustainability and brand image more visible to customers and investors. |
| 2019 | Battery materials expansion | The push into battery cathode materials improved how Umicore positions itself in the market as a supplier to electrification, which supported Umicore green technology branding. |
| 2024 | EV slowdown and project pressure | Slower electric-vehicle momentum and project setbacks put pressure on Umicore investor perception and brand strength, showing that reputation tracks execution as much as theme exposure. |
The most consequential shift was the exit from mining, because it changed the base story behind Umicore brand development over time. That move made the Umicore business model and brand value easier to connect to circular economy and industrial transition themes, and it helped anchor Umicore corporate reputation strategy. Later gains in recycling and battery materials built on that base, but the mining exit did the heaviest work in changing what makes Umicore a trusted brand.
Umicore Balanced Scorecard
- Clean, Modern, and Easy to Present
- No Research Needed – Save Hours of Work
- Built by Experts, Trusted by Consultants
- Instant Download, Ready to Use
- 100% Editable, Fully Customizable
What Does Umicore's History Say About Its Brand Today?
Umicore history says its brand is durable, technical, and purpose driven, but still tied to performance. Since 1906, the Umicore company brand has been built less on public fame and more on industrial trust, which is why its reputational strength still depends on reliability in catalysts, recycling, and battery materials.
Umicore brand development over time shows one clear signal: it has stayed relevant through major shifts in metals, energy, and mobility. That continuity is central to how Umicore built its brand trust through sustainability and how Umicore positions itself in the market today.
Its Umicore recycling business and catalyst work give the brand practical proof, not just claims. The Brand Expansion of Umicore Company mirrors that shift from legacy metals to cleaner materials.
The same history that supports Umicore corporate branding also makes it sensitive to execution. If plants, margins, or battery materials demand weaken, the brand can lose part of its premium because Umicore investor perception and brand strength are tied to results.
That is the tension in Umicore corporate reputation strategy: strong Umicore sustainability strategy and green technology branding help the story, but the market still wants proof. In other words, Umicore sustainability and brand image must keep pace with operations, or the promise gets questioned.
Umicore VRIO Analysis
- Designed for Fast Business Analysis
- Structured for Consultants, Students, and Founders
- 100% Editable in Microsoft Word & Excel
- Instant Digital Download – Use Immediately
- Compatible with Mac & PC – Fully Unlocked
Related Blogs
- Who Connects Most Strongly With the Brand of Umicore Company?
- How Does Umicore Company Turn Brand Trust Into Sales and Demand?
- Can Umicore Company Grow Without Weakening Its Brand?
- How Does Umicore Company Work and Support Its Brand Promise?
- Who Owns Umicore Company and How Does Ownership Affect Trust in the Brand?
- How Strong Is Umicore Company's Brand Position Against Competitors?
- What Do the Mission, Vision, and Values of Umicore Company Say About Its Brand Purpose?
Frequently Asked Questions
Umicore was first seen as a heavy industrial metals business. Its 1906 roots in Union Minière du Haut Katanga gave it scale and credibility, while its early mining and metallurgy focus created trust around process expertise. That first image lasted for decades, but it also tied Umicore to an extractive legacy that later needed a 2001 reset.
Disclaimer
All information, articles, and product details provided on this website are for general informational and educational purposes only. We do not claim any ownership over, nor do we intend to infringe upon, any trademarks, copyrights, logos, brand names, or other intellectual property mentioned or depicted on this site. Such intellectual property remains the property of its respective owners, and any references here are made solely for identification or informational purposes, without implying any affiliation, endorsement, or partnership.
We make no representations or warranties, express or implied, regarding the accuracy, completeness, or suitability of any content or products presented. Nothing on this website should be construed as legal, tax, investment, financial, medical, or other professional advice. In addition, no part of this site - including articles or product references - constitutes a solicitation, recommendation, endorsement, advertisement, or offer to buy or sell any securities, franchises, or other financial instruments, particularly in jurisdictions where such activity would be unlawful.
All content is of a general nature and may not address the specific circumstances of any individual or entity. It is not a substitute for professional advice or services. Any actions you take based on the information provided here are strictly at your own risk. You accept full responsibility for any decisions or outcomes arising from your use of this website and agree to release us from any liability in connection with your use of, or reliance upon, the content or products found herein.